CXC to improve service to education stakeholders with new platform

spot_img

by Randy Bennett (Barbados Today) The Caribbean Examinations Council (CXC) says its new Data Intelligence Gateway online platform will allow it to serve its regional stakeholders more efficiently.

The new gateway is a central website that will provide dashboards of various categories of information. It will allow Ministries of Education across the region and examination centres to access necessary information such as statistics on electronic school-based assessments (e-SBAs), registrations, and results.

CXC registrar and chief executive officer Dr Wayne Wesley said the regional examinations body is undergoing digital transformation aimed at providing improved and more efficient services.

“Digital transformation is more than a catchphrase for us at CXC, it is our vision. As this year marks our 50th anniversary of serving the region, CXC’s vision is to become a digitally transformed enterprise providing quality, relevant, and globally recognised educational services. Accordingly, CXC is transforming for greater regional impact and we are doing this through our e-transition framework,” he said on Tuesday at the launch of the initiative at the Auditorium Conference Centre, Government Campus Plaza in Trinidad and Tobago.
